solve the equation for exact solutions. 3 arccos x = 2π solve the equation for exact solutions. select the correct choice below and, if necessary, fill in the answer box within your choice. o a. the solution set is. (simplify your answer, including any radicals. use integers or fractions for any numbers in the expression.) o b. the solution is the empty set.

Answer

Explanation:

Step1: Isolate arccos x

Divide both sides of the equation $3\arccos x = 2\pi$ by 3. We get $\arccos x=\frac{2\pi}{3}$.

Step2: Use the definition of arccosine

If $\arccos x = \theta$, then $x=\cos\theta$. Here $\theta=\frac{2\pi}{3}$, and $\cos(\frac{2\pi}{3})=-\frac{1}{2}$.

Answer:

A. The solution set is $\left{-\frac{1}{2}\right}$
